目的探讨PTEN基因转染对人舌癌细胞系SCC-4凋亡的影响及其作用机制。方法将转染PTEN的SCC-4(pEGFP-PTEN-SCC-4)细胞作为实验组,以SCC-4和pEGFP-SCC-4作为对照,流式细胞仪检测3组细胞凋亡情况;应用Western blotting法检测3组中Akt、p-Akt、Bim的表达情况。结果流式细胞仪检测结果显示,实验组细胞凋亡率比对照组明显增高(P<0.01);Western blotting结果显示,各组细胞间总Akt水平差异不明显;p-Akt在实验组中表达明显低于对照组;Bim在实验组中表达明显高于对照组。结论 PTEN转染能够诱导SCC-4的凋亡,可能机制是负调控PI3K/Akt信号通路并上调Bim的表达。
Objective To investigate the effect of PTEN gene transfection on the apoptosis of human tongue cancer cell line SCC-4 and its mechanism. Methods The SCC-4 (pEGFP-PTEN-SCC-4) cells transfected with PTEN were used as experimental group and the apoptosis of three groups was detected by flow cytometry with SCC-4 and pEGFP-SCC-4 as controls. The expressions of Akt, p-Akt and Bim in three groups were detected by blotting. Results The results of flow cytometry showed that the apoptotic rate in the experimental group was significantly higher than that in the control group (P <0.01). The results of Western blotting showed that there was no significant difference in the total Akt between the groups. The expression of p-Akt in the experimental group Significantly lower than the control group; Bim in the experimental group was significantly higher than the control group. Conclusions PTEN transfection can induce the apoptosis of SCC-4. The possible mechanism is that it negatively regulates the PI3K / Akt signaling pathway and up-regulates Bim expression.
